Building a successful teen patti tournament app requires more than a pretty UI and a functioning deck of cards. As a seasoned developer and product lead who has shipped multiplayer card games and real-money skill games, I’ve seen firsthand what separates apps that attract long-term players from those that fizzle out after launch. This guide distills practical engineering, product, legal, and growth strategies for anyone aiming to be a leading teen patti tournament app developer.
For reference, you can view an established platform here: keywords.
Why tournaments matter for retention and monetization
Tournaments transform casual play into a recurring habit. They create scheduled excitement, community rituals, and higher lifetime value. A well-designed tournament system increases session length, boosts daily active users (DAU), and drives social sharing—critical for organic growth.
Think of a tournament as a weekly neighborhood poker night: players mark their calendars, invite friends, and return even if they didn’t win last time. As a developer, your role is to reliably recreate that emotional rhythm at scale.
Core features every teen patti tournament app needs
- Multiple tournament types: Sit & Go, scheduled tournaments, freerolls, knockouts, and leagues.
- Flexible buy-in and prize structures: Guaranteed prize pools, tiered payouts, rebuys/add-ons, and rake management.
- Matchmaking and seeding: Balanced pairing to reduce early mismatches and ensure competitive fairness.
- Leaderboards and progression: Seasonal leaderboards, badges, and rank progression to encourage repeat play.
- Real-time chat and social features: Tableside chat, friend invites, and spectating to build community.
- Robust anti-fraud systems: Collusion detection, bot detection, and behavioral analytics.
- Secure payments and wallet: Multiple payment rails, KYC where required, and transparent transaction flows.
Technical architecture and real-time requirements
Real-time gameplay is the heartbeat of any card tournament app. Low latency, deterministic state, and robust reconnection logic matter more than flashy animations. Below are pragmatic choices I’ve used successfully:
- Back end concurrency: Use languages and frameworks optimized for concurrency—Golang, Elixir (Phoenix), or Node.js with clustering. They handle thousands of concurrent socket connections reliably.
- Real-time transport: WebSockets for persistent bi-directional communication. For ultra-low-latency environments consider protocols built on UDP, but for broad compatibility WebSockets are ideal.
- Game state management: Keep authoritative game state on the server to prevent cheating. Clients are thin and used primarily for rendering and input.
- Scaling: Use stateless front-facing services with a stateful game server layer. Autoscale lobby and match servers independently based on load.
- Persistence: Use a combination of in-memory stores (Redis) for fast session state and durable databases (Postgres, CockroachDB) for transaction logs and audit trails.
- Matchmaking & queuing: Implement a queueing service that creates balanced tables quickly while respecting prize structures and buy-in tiers.
Fairness, RNG, and certification
Player trust is non-negotiable. Use cryptographically secure random number generators (CSPRNG) and maintain deterministic shuffles server-side. For operators handling real-money play, third-party testing and certification from recognized labs (e.g., independent testing bodies) provide credibility and reduce disputes.
Keep detailed audit logs of shuffles, hand histories, and financial transactions. Providing transparent mechanisms for dispute resolution and visible transaction histories increases user confidence.
Security, compliance, and responsible play
Regulatory compliance varies widely by jurisdiction. Key practices include:
- Age and geolocation checks: Prevent underage play and block regions where gameplay is restricted.
- KYC and AML: Implement tiered KYC flows for withdrawals and high-value activity. Be mindful of privacy regulations (e.g., GDPR) when storing identity documents.
- Data protection: Encrypt sensitive data at rest and in transit, implement regular penetration tests, and follow secure coding standards.
- Responsible gaming: Options for self-exclusion, deposit limits, cooldown periods, and clear terms of service.
User experience (UX) and accessibility
Great UX reduces churn. A few decisions that matter:
- Onboarding: Use interactive tutorials and small initial freerolls so new players learn mechanics without risking funds.
- Clear affordances: Show tournament start times, buy-in amounts, prize breakdowns, and seat counts at a glance.
- Adaptive UI: Ensure the UI scales across phones and tablets—cards, chips, and buttons must remain readable and tappable.
- Latency feedback: Display reconnection states and estimated ping so players aren’t surprised when disconnects occur.
- Accessibility: High-contrast modes, larger text settings, and voice-over support expand your audience and show maturity as a product.
Monetization and economic balance
Successful tournament apps combine multiple revenue streams while keeping gameplay fair:
- Rake: A percentage of each pot or entry fee; set carefully to maintain player trust.
- Entry fees and buy-ins: Tiered buy-ins to cater to casual and high-stakes players.
- In-app purchases: Cosmetic items, avatars, tournament passes, or VIP subscriptions.
- Ads: Rewarded ads for free chips or boosters—should never be intrusive during competitive play.
- Sponsorships and live events: Branded tournaments or partnerships with influencers for user acquisition boosts.
Analytics, KPIs, and iteration
Measure what matters. Core metrics include:
- DAU/MAU and stickiness ratios
- Retention curves (D1, D7, D30)
- LTV, ARPU, and ARPPU
- Churn reasons from exit funnels and session recordings
- Tournament-specific KPIs: fill rate, average seats per tournament, average prize per player
Use A/B testing for onboarding flows, tournament schedules, and prize structures. Even minor changes to buy-in displays or prize formatting can have outsized effects on conversion and retention.
Marketing, acquisition, and community building
Technical excellence is necessary but not sufficient. Growth depends on smart acquisition and community:
- App Store Optimization (ASO): Keywords, visually compelling screenshots, and localized store listings.
- Referral programs: Reward both referrer and referee with tournament tickets or chips.
- Influencer partnerships: Streamed tournaments, co-branded events, and influencer-hosted freerolls work well for reach.
- Social features: Encourage sharing results, achievements, and leaderboard placements.
- Retention loops: Daily rewards tied to tournament participation and loyalty programs.
Testing and rollout strategy
Ship in stages: closed alpha with internal testers, invite-only beta for active community members, and phased rollout by geography. Load testing with simulated concurrency is essential—nothing reveals weaknesses faster than an unexpected spike around a popular tournament. Also, maintain a robust rollback and hotfix plan.
Case example: a tournament feature I built
In one project, we launched a weekly guaranteed prize tournament aimed at mid-stakes players. Initially we saw high signups but low completion—players sat out at final tables due to unclear payouts and long waiting times between rounds. We solved this by shortening blind intervals, showing progressive prize visualizations, and introducing a mid-tournament mini-reward. Completion rates and social shares rose 27% within three weeks. This taught me that small UX adjustments tied to economic incentives can produce tangible retention gains.
Roadmap checklist for developers
- Define tournament types and economic rules
- Build authoritative server-side game engine
- Implement secure wallet and compliant payments
- Integrate CSPRNG and plan for third-party certification
- Deploy anti-fraud, collusion, and bot detection
- Design onboarding, tutorials, and social flows
- Prepare analytics, A/B testing, and gradual rollout
- Plan marketing: ASO, influencers, referrals
- Maintain clear legal and responsible gaming policies
Final thoughts
Becoming a standout teen patti tournament app developer means balancing technical rigor with empathetic product design. Players reward fairness, clarity, and community. Engineers, product managers, designers, and compliance experts must collaborate early to deliver a secure, delightful experience that scales.
For inspiration from an active platform, check this link: keywords. If you’re building your first tournament module, start small, measure everything, and iterate quickly—every tournament is a chance to learn and improve.